/* Contribution styles. */
.required_input_here {  color: #FF0000}
.body_text {  font-family: Arial, Helvetica, sans-serif; font-size: 12px}
.subhead {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old}
.header {  font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bold}
.header_big {  font-family: Arial, Helvetica, sans-serif; font-size: 16px; font-weight: bold}

/* Sitewide tag styles. */
p {  font-family: Arial, Helvetica, sans-serif; font-size: 12px}
ul {  font-family: Arial, Helvetica, sans-serif; font-size: 12px}

/*=============================
new 2009 by Anne to fix nav color issues*/
a:link {color: #c33;}
a:visited {color: #900;}
a:hover {color: #f66;}
a:active {color: #c33;}

/* MasterPage styles. */
.btmnav {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#A4001D; text-decoration: none}
.sidenav {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#a4001d; text-decoration: none; font-weight: bold}
.sidenavhi {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#18481d; text-decoration: none}
/*================
new*/
.btmnav a {color: #A4001D; text-decoration: none;}
.sidenav a {color: #a4001d; text-decoration: none;}
.sidenavhi a {color: #a4001d; text-decoration: none;}

/* test table styles. */
.table_header {  font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bold; background-color: #CFDFC7}
.table_right {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; text-align: right}
.table_top {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; vertical-align: top}
.table_btm {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; vertical-align: baseline}
td {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; vertical-align: top}


/* For Home Page rollover navigation and footer */
.homenav {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; line-height: 13px; color: #18481D; text-decoration: none}
.homenav_hi {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; line-height: 13px; font-weight: bold; color: #18481D; text-decoration: none}
.hometable {  padding-left: 4px}
.snippet2 {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#AFC4A4; text-decoration: none}
/*================
new*/
.homenav a {color: #18481D; text-decoration: none;}
.homenav_hi a {color: #18481D; text-decoration: none;}
.snippet2 a {color: #AFC4A4; text-decoration: none;}


/* apply to "Did you know..." tip teasers, as on the provider relations page in "Providers" */
.tip { 
background: #CFDFC7; 
border: solid; 
padding: 5px 5px
; font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#18481D
; border-width: 0px 2px 2px 0px; border-color: #18481D #537851 #537851 #18481D
}
.table_middle {  vertical-align: middle}
.footer {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#AFC4A4; text-decoration: none}
/*================
new*/
.footer a {color: #AFC4A4; text-decoration: none;}

/* apply to vmc policies */
.thin_divider {
border-color: #537851; 
border-width: 0px 0px 1px 0px"
}